Handi-Crafters Honors Key ‘Best Friends’ With Inaugural Award

By

Bob & Jennifer McNeil

The prominent givers of the gift of an opportunity to develop newfound abilities are themselves being given an honor by the many faces behind Thorndale-based Handi-Crafters.

The non-profit organization’s inaugural Best Friend Award will be bestowed upon Mr. and Mrs. Robert McNeil of Coatesville on Friday, April 10, during its Around the World gala fundraiser featuring international food and wine pairings.

“We are very fortunate and honored by the support bestowed on our operations and our mission by generous donors, customers and corporations,” a Handi-Crafters announcement this week stated. “This award will give us an opportunity to say thank you and truly honor our gracious and treasured friends. Bob and Jennifer McNeil are no strangers in Chester County for their philanthropy; they have given tirelessly of their time, professional guidance and generous funding to many organizations.”

In addition to being annual supporters, the McNeil’s contributions stretch back a decade, highlighted by Bob’s year as board co-chair and leader of the $3 million building campaign that spurred Handi-Crafters’ renovation and program expansion.

“There have been projects and operations at Handi-Crafters that could never have been achieved without the support of Bob and Jennifer,” Past Board President Robert Spatola said in the news release.

The award presentation will commence during the $135 business casual event running from 6 to 10 p.m. at the Phoenixville Foundry and is underwritten by Legendary sponsor First Niagara Bank.
